Residensi Tribeca in Kuala Lumpur, Kuala Lumpur recorded 10 subsale transactions between 2021 and 2026, with a median price of RM1.01 million and a median price per square foot (PSF) of RM1,644.

This area consists exclusively of residential properties, with no commercial listings recorded.

Price remained flat, and PSF growth was PSF remained flat. The median price is RM1.01 million, with most transactions falling within a stable range of RM930K to RM1.09 million, and a typical market range of RM963K to RM1.06 million.

Most transactions involved serviced apartment, with minimal variety in property types.

For price per square foot, the median is RM1,644, with most transactions between RM1,571 and RM1,717. The usual range is RM1,575.01 to RM1,712.51, showing that most units are priced quite close to each other. With an IQR of RM137.50 and MAD of RM73, the PSF demonstrates reasonable consistency across the market.
